Liability for Robotic Malfunctions

Liability for robotic malfunctions pertains to determining responsibility when a robotic device fails to operate as intended, causing harm or damages. This area is central to the evolving robotics and consumer rights laws, especially given the increasing integration of robotics into daily life.

Legal frameworks often seek to assign liability based on factors such as manufacturer negligence, product defectiveness, or failure to adhere to safety standards. In many jurisdictions, strict liability may apply, holding manufacturers accountable regardless of fault if a defect caused the malfunction. However, the specific legal duties vary across regions and products.

Legal Responsibilities of Manufacturers

Manufacturers bear specific legal responsibilities in ensuring the safety and reliability of robotic products supplied to consumers. These responsibilities are crucial in maintaining consumer trust and adhering to robotics law standards. Key obligations include the following:

  1. Ensuring Compliance with Safety Standards: Manufacturers must design robotic devices that meet established safety regulations and industry standards. Failure to comply can result in liability for damages caused by malfunctions.

  2. Providing Accurate Information: They are legally required to disclose essential details about the robotic product’s capabilities, limitations, and potential risks to consumers, fostering transparency.

  3. Addressing Defects and Malfunctions: In cases of faulty or defective robotics, manufacturers are responsible for warranties, repairs, or replacements. This obligation helps protect consumer rights and maintains product integrity.

  4. Monitoring and Recall Procedures: If safety issues are identified post-market, manufacturers must initiate recalls and notify consumers promptly, minimizing harm and legal exposure.

By fulfilling these responsibilities, manufacturers align their practices with robotics law, ensuring consumer protection and fostering industry accountability.

The Role of International and Regional Laws in Robotics Consumer Protections

International and regional laws significantly influence the development and enforcement of robotics consumer protections across different jurisdictions. These legal frameworks aim to harmonize safety standards, liability, and privacy protections for robotic devices used by consumers worldwide.

Regional laws, such as the European Union’s General Data Protection Regulation (GDPR), establish strict data privacy and security obligations that manufacturers must adhere to, setting a precedent for other regions. The GDPR also enforces transparency and accountability in how consumer data is collected, processed, and stored.

International agreements, like those facilitated by the United Nations, facilitate cooperation on safety standards and liability frameworks, although they are less binding than regional laws. Such treaties promote sharing best practices and creating unified legislative approaches, making it easier for companies to comply across borders.

Overall, the role of international and regional laws helps create a cohesive legal environment for robotics and consumer rights laws, ensuring better protection for consumers globally and encouraging responsible innovation within the industry.

Practical Guidance for Consumers Navigating Robotics and Laws

Consumers should familiarize themselves with existing consumer rights laws related to robotics and laws before purchasing robotic devices. Understanding laws surrounding liability, warranties, and data privacy ensures better protection and informed decision-making.

It is advisable to carefully read product disclosures, safety standards, and user agreements provided by manufacturers. Transparency and disclosure obligations are key aspects of robotics law that can influence consumer recourse in case of malfunction or data breaches.

Consumers are encouraged to document issues meticulously, including photographs, maintenance records, and communication logs. This documentation can be crucial if legal action or disputes regarding repairs, replacements, or liability arise under current laws.

Finally, staying informed about evolving legislation for autonomous and AI-driven robotics can help consumers anticipate future rights and responsibilities. Regularly consulting legal resources or consumer protection agencies enhances awareness and facilitates better navigation within the robotics and consumer rights laws landscape.
